WebTruck driver stress is real and caused by long hours, heavy traffic, and constant deadlines. It can have serious health consequences if not appropriately managed. Truck drivers must get enough rest, eat healthily, and exercise regularly to reduce stress. Taking breaks whenever necessary is also essential.
